Chu His's The Book of History studying had critical influence on the following scholars. Since then, scholars began to doubt The Book of History's reliability. Chu His opened up a new field in the study of The Book of History.Han Yu, a famous scholar in Tang Dynasty, suggested expounding The Spring and Autumn Annals liberally, and abandoning the basis of ex-scholars' interpretations. This skeptical attitude on the Five Classics grew to be a trend of thought in Song Dynasty. It provided thoughts for Chu His and made Chu His's achievements on the study of The Book of History accepted easily . Cheng Hao and Cheng yi, two great thinkers in Song Dynasty, began to interpret The Book of History in Neo-Confucianism. And Chu His expounded The Book of History just on the basis of the Neo-Confucianism. Wang Anshi, Su Shi, Lin Zhiqi and Lv Zuqian advanced to explain the hidden meanings of The Book of History. They put forward their individual ideals by explaining Confucian Classics and struggled each other in ideological field. Chu His carried on their achievements fully.In the Chunxi thirteenth years(DC. 1186),Chu His began to prepare to explain The Book of History. In his later years, Chu His discussed many problems on The Book of History with his friends and students. During the course of discussion, his thoughts on The Book of History formed gradually. Chu His only interpreted five articles of The Book of History and quoted forty-five books. In The Book of History's research , He absorbed the merits of the way by which the scholars in Han-Tang Dynasties and Song Dynasty had done their scholarly research, and attained many achievements. The five articles which Chu His explained were the outstanding examples for Cai Chen's Shujizhuan. Chu His doubted the reliabilities of the total preface and essay preface, and doubted the reliabilities of Guwenshangshu and doubted if Kong Anguo had interpreted The Book of History. These thoughts influenced the following scholars greatly.Chu His had great interests in Buddhist philosophy and Taoist scriptures in his early years. When he was a disciple of Li Tong, Chu His concentrated his attention on Confucian Classics and formed his theory in his middle years. In his late years, Chu His paid more attention on The Book of Rites. The Book of History did not take key role in Chu His' thoughts. Chu His' value judgments and life experiences in his late years had something to do with his unfinished interpretation on The Book of History.Cai Chen's family had scholarly origin with Chu His. Cai Chen continued his father's learning about Hongfan and completed a work of Hongfanhuangjineipian. So Chu His passed on his research on The Book of History to Cai Chen. But Cai Chen's explanation had differences from Chu His in stylistic rules. So some scholars quoted the viewpoints of Chu to oppose Cai.Chu His had changed meanings of many concepts and it embodied his value judgments. To Chu His, explaining Confucian Classics was just a tool that can cultivate one's moral characters and make the society turn a new leaf, and also protect Confucianism. Chu His paid not much attention to explain Confucian Classics word by word. He doubted the reliabilities of The Book of History and changed its word order. He recognized that the formation of The Book of History had experienced a long period and could be interpreted by Neo-Confucianism.
